Carter's

Carter’s, Inc. (Carter’s) is a branded marketer of apparel for babies and young children in the United States. The Company owns two brand names in the children’s apparel industry, Carter’s and OshKosh. Its Carter’s brand provides apparel for children sizes ranging from newborn to seven. OshKosh brand provides its line of apparel for children sizes newborn to 12. Its Carter’s, OshKosh, and related brands are sold to national department stores, chain and specialty stores and discount retailers. As of December 31, 2011, the Company operated 359 Carter’s and 170 OshKosh outlet and brand retail stores in the United States and 65 retail stores in Canada. On June 30, 2011, the Company acquired Bonnie Togs, a Canadian children’s apparel retailer and a former international licensee. In March 2012, the Company opened its Canadian flagship store at Vaughan Mills, which is a 7,300 square foot store, located at one Bass Pro Mills Drive.

Skip Hop

Acquisition in 2017
Skip Hop, Inc. is a New York-based manufacturer and distributor of childcare products designed for parents, babies, and toddlers. Established in 2003 by parents Ellen and Michael Diamant, the company focuses on creating innovative and functional items that address common parenting challenges. Its product range includes diaper bags, children's backpacks, outdoor blankets, cooler bags, and various accessories for feeding, bathing, and nursery care. Skip Hop's offerings are available through a network of retailers and department stores both domestically and internationally, as well as through its online platform. In 2017, Skip Hop became a subsidiary of Carter's, Inc., further enhancing its market reach and capabilities.
